Output 8e59e5379f3af99f6602649d1d514a5446f8d7268c40b6011d4fa534de4f77ac:1

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 986eb4f8c31ca49402b7d77e83a8f793921662a8 OP_EQUAL
address
A6LFzbjYwRSn2eJRvCYAJ1YPhqNhJe4zXj
transaction
8e59e5379f3af99f6602649d1d514a5446f8d7268c40b6011d4fa534de4f77ac